This article outlines five frameworks for regenerative landscapes, with permaculture as the ethical foundation complemented by Regrarians and Syntropic Agroforestry for practical design. Permaculture provides ethics (earth care, people care, fair share), principles, and concepts for holistic harmony. Regrarians Platform, by Darren Doherty from P.A. Yeomans' Keyline Scale of Permanence, structures broad-acre planning across 12 factors: climate, water, access, economy, etc., prioritizing water via keyline plows—parallel contours offsetting ridges for even distribution, uniform pasture growth, infiltration. Steps: survey topography, mark keypoints (valley floor inflections), design primary/secondary keylines for dams, irrigation. Syntropic Agroforestry mimics forest succession for dynamic, economic ecosystems: principles include 100% ground cover (living/dead matter) via dense prunings; maximize photosynthesis through high-density planting; stacking plants by height/successional stage (pioneer legumes to climax fruits); succession planning 20-50 year timelines; continuous management—pruning biomass as mulch/fertilizer. Implementation: plant 10,000 trees/ha initially, chop-and-drop every 3-6 months to accelerate decomposition, boost soil carbon. Case examples restore degraded lands, increasing biodiversity, yields (e.g., 20t/ha biomass/year). Compared to permaculture's breadth, Regrarians excels in scale/logic for farms, Syntropics in tropical stacking for food/ timber.
